发明名称 Periodic signal generators having microelectromechanical resonators therein that support generation of high frequency low-TCF difference signals
摘要 A periodic signal generator is configured to generate high frequency signals characterized by relatively low temperature coefficients of frequency (TCF). A microelectromechanical resonator, such as concave bulk acoustic resonator (CBAR) supporting capacitive and piezoelectric transduction, may be geometrically engineered as a signal generator that produces two periodic signals having unequal resonant frequencies with unequal temperature coefficients. Circuitry is also provided for combining the two periodic signals using a mixer to thereby yield a high frequency low-TCF periodic difference signal at an output of the periodic signal generator.

主权项 1. A periodic signal generator, comprising: an oscillator comprising a microelectromechanical bulk acoustic resonator having a piezoelectric layer therein and drive and sense electrodes on the piezoelectric layer, said oscillator configured to generate first and second periodic signals having unequal first and second frequencies (f1, f2), said first and second periodic signals characterized by respective first and second temperature coefficients of frequency (TCf1, TCf2) that differ by at least about 10 ppm/° C.; a frequency multiplier responsive to the first periodic signal, said frequency multiplier configured to generate a periodic output signal having a frequency equal to N times a frequency of the first periodic signal, where N is a real number greater than one; and a mixer circuit configured to generate a periodic beat signal in response to the second periodic signal and the periodic output signal, said periodic beat signal having a frequency fb equal to f2−Nf1 and a temperature coefficient of frequency (TCfb) of less than a smaller of the absolute value of TCf1 and TCf2.
